Lore & Background

The gem's significance lies in its role as a tool for Dream's power, not as an anchor against any cosmic void. Created by Morpheus himself as a focus for his authority, the Ruby of Dream was never a sustainer of life or a counterbalance to entropy. Its history is marked by its theft by the sorcerer Roderick Burgess, who used it to imprison Dream, and later by its destruction at the hands of John Dee, who attempted to reshape reality with it. The ruby was eventually reformed as a dream within the Dreaming, a testament to Dream's enduring will.
